How the 6x9 Inch No‑Bleed Format Removes Publishing Headaches

One of the quiet frustrations in KDP publishing hits during the upload preview: a red error because an image drifts past the trim line. The 7 Days Detailed Daily Planner KDP interior explicitly comes with No Bleed setup, sized precisely at 6x9 inches. For someone who is not a graphic designer, this detail alone saves hours. There’s no need to calculate safety margins or re‑export pages. The 120‑page file is ready to drop into KDP’s paperback creator, and the text sits comfortably inside print boundaries.

This no‑bleed approach also changes how people think about interior design. When elements don’t have to extend to the edge, the layout breathes better. A daily planner page for Wednesday, for instance, can feature a clear border, generous writing space, and a header that doesn’t get clipped. The trade‑off—no full‑page background colors bleeding off‑edge—actually encourages a cleaner, more modern aesthetic that many buyers appreciate. Combined with the 300 DPI resolution, the printed result looks professionally typeset, not like a cobbled‑together home printout.

Practical Steps for Customizing and Launching Your Planner

Adopting the 7 days detailed daily planner interior doesn’t require a month of design work. If you have Adobe Illustrator, you can open the AI file, unlock the text layers, and retype section labels. To change colors, select global swatches and override them. The free font used is already embedded, so there’s no panic about missing typefaces. For those who prefer not to touch vector graphics at all, the high‑resolution JPEG files allow a simple workflow: import them into a program like Affinity Publisher or even PowerPoint, then re‑export as a print‑ready PDF set to the correct size.

A pragmatic sequence looks like this:

  1. Decide on a niche and adjust daily headers accordingly. Keep the core 7‑day structure intact; the repetition is what habitual planners want.
  2. If needed, alter the cover or add an introductory page, but remember the interior file already contains 120 ready pages. Don’t over‑complicate—too many custom pages can break the no‑bleed rhythm.
  3. Export the PDF and run a quick KDP preview. Since it’s Amazon tested, errors should be absent, but a final glance catches any accidental layer shifts.
  4. Upload, set pricing, and craft a product description that highlights the detailed daily aspect. Mention the 7‑day layout prominently; buyers searching for weekly planners often type exactly that phrase.
